天道PHP蜘蛛池是一款高效的网络爬虫工具,它利用PHP语言构建,能够轻松实现大规模、高效率的网页数据采集。该工具通过整合多个蜘蛛池,实现了对多个网站的同时抓取,大大提高了爬虫的效率和覆盖范围。天道PHP蜘蛛池还具备强大的数据过滤和清洗功能,能够自动去除重复数据,并保留有价值的信息。这款工具广泛应用于市场调研、竞争对手分析、网站内容更新等领域,是企业和个人进行网络数据采集的得力助手。
在数字化时代,网络信息的获取和分析变得愈发重要,对于企业和个人而言,如何从海量互联网数据中提取有价值的信息,成为了一个关键课题,而网络爬虫技术,作为信息获取的重要手段,正逐渐受到广泛关注,本文将深入探讨一种高效的网络爬虫解决方案——天道PHP蜘蛛池,解析其技术原理、实现方式以及在实际应用中的优势。
一、网络爬虫技术概述
网络爬虫,又称网络机器人或网页抓取工具,是一种按照一定规则自动抓取互联网信息的程序,它通过模拟人的行为,对网页进行访问、解析并提取所需数据,网络爬虫技术广泛应用于搜索引擎、数据分析、信息监控等多个领域。
二、天道PHP蜘蛛池简介
天道PHP蜘蛛池是一款基于PHP语言开发的、高效的网络爬虫系统,它采用分布式架构,支持多节点并发抓取,能够大幅提高数据获取的速度和效率,天道PHP蜘蛛池还具备强大的数据解析能力,能够轻松应对各种复杂的网页结构。
三、技术原理与实现方式
1. 分布式架构
天道PHP蜘蛛池采用分布式架构,将爬虫任务分配到多个节点上执行,每个节点都具备独立的IP地址和访问权限,能够同时访问多个目标网站,这种设计不仅提高了爬虫的并发性,还增强了系统的可扩展性。
2. 爬虫引擎
爬虫引擎是天道PHP蜘蛛池的核心组件,负责控制整个爬取过程,它采用多线程技术,能够同时处理多个爬取任务,在爬取过程中,爬虫引擎会不断向目标网站发送请求,并接收返回的响应数据,通过对响应数据的解析和过滤,引擎能够提取出所需的信息。
3. 数据解析与存储
天道PHP蜘蛛池支持多种数据解析方式,包括正则表达式、XPath、CSS选择器等,用户可以根据网页的实际情况选择合适的解析方式,快速提取所需数据,系统还提供了丰富的数据存储接口,支持将爬取的数据保存到本地文件、数据库或远程服务器中。
4. 爬虫管理界面
为了方便用户管理和监控爬虫任务,天道PHP蜘蛛池还提供了一个直观的管理界面,用户可以通过该界面查看当前正在运行的爬虫任务、已完成的爬取任务以及爬取到的数据,管理界面还提供了丰富的配置选项和日志记录功能,方便用户进行调试和故障排查。
四、实际应用与优势分析
1. 信息采集与监控
在信息爆炸的时代,及时准确地获取各类信息变得至关重要,天道PHP蜘蛛池能够高效地从多个网站中采集所需信息,并将其保存到本地或远程数据库中,通过设定特定的关键词或规则,用户可以轻松实现信息监控和预警功能,企业可以定期爬取竞争对手的官方网站和社交媒体平台,了解市场动态和竞争对手的动向;政府部门可以爬取各类政策文件和公告信息,提高决策效率和准确性。
2. 数据挖掘与分析
天道PHP蜘蛛池支持对爬取到的数据进行深度挖掘和分析,通过构建数据模型、进行数据挖掘算法训练等步骤,用户可以挖掘出隐藏在数据背后的规律和趋势,电商平台可以利用爬虫技术获取竞争对手的商品信息和价格数据,进行市场分析和价格策略调整;金融机构可以爬取各类金融数据和信息,进行风险评估和决策支持等。
3. 网站优化与SEO推广
对于网站运营人员来说,了解竞争对手的SEO策略和网站优化情况至关重要,通过天道PHP蜘蛛池可以方便地爬取竞争对手的网页内容、关键词分布以及外部链接等信息,这些信息有助于指导网站优化工作,提高网站的排名和流量,通过爬取行业相关的优质内容资源并进行分析和借鉴,还可以提升网站的原创性和质量水平。
五、安全与合规性考虑
在使用网络爬虫技术时,必须严格遵守相关法律法规和道德规范,天道PHP蜘蛛池在设计时充分考虑了安全与合规性问题:一方面通过模拟人类行为的方式降低被目标网站封禁的风险;另一方面通过设定合理的访问频率和请求头信息来避免对目标网站造成过大的负担或干扰;此外还提供了丰富的反爬虫策略配置选项以满足不同场景下的需求。
六、总结与展望
天道PHP蜘蛛池作为一款高效的网络爬虫系统具有广泛的应用前景和巨大的商业价值,它不仅能够提高信息获取的速度和效率还能为数据分析、数据挖掘等提供有力支持,随着技术的不断发展和完善相信未来会有更多优秀的网络爬虫工具涌现出来为各行各业的发展注入新的活力!